RAILWAYMEN’S DECISION
Press Association DUNEDIN, Thursday. The following resolution was carried unanimously at a mass meeting of employees held in the yard at the Hillside railway workshops to-day during the lunch hour:—“That this meeting protests against any form of the premium bonus system being introduced in the railway workshops.”
